THE CW NETWORK SETS BROADCAST SCHEDULE FOR 2025-26 ACC MEN'S AND WOMEN'S BASKETBALL

Men's Basketball Tips Off on Saturday, November 8, with Western Carolina at Duke

Women's Basketball Begins Saturday, November 22, with Kentucky at Louisville

BURBANK, CA (October 7, 2025) - The CW Network today announced the broadcast schedule for the 2025-26 ACC men's and women's basketball season. Beginning in November, The CW will enter its third season broadcasting 28 men's basketball games and 12 women's basketball games.

ACC men's basketball on The CW begins on Saturday, November 8, with a non-conference showdown featuring the Western Carolina Catamounts visiting the 2025 ACC champion and Final Four participant Duke Blue Devils live from Durham, NC, beginning at 1:30 p.m. ET. Other highlights of the schedule include a conference battle between the Wake Forest Demon Deacons and the Duke Blue Devils on Saturday, January 24, 2026, and two tripleheader Saturdays on January 31, 2026, and March 7, 2026.

ACC women's basketball on The CW tips off on Saturday, November 22, with the Kentucky Wildcats taking on the Louisville Cardinals beginning at 2:00 p.m. ET. Other key matchups include the SMU Mustangs visiting the 2025 ACC champion Duke Blue Devils on Sunday, February 8, 2026, and two doubleheader Sundays on February 1, 2026, and February 22, 2026.

Raycom Sports will produce all games for The CW.
